Nearly one year after suffering debilitating injuries in a car crash, Tracy Morgan continues to speak out about how his family has helped him recover.
But in a new interview, the 46-year-old actor revealed his youngest child, 23-month-old daughter Maven, was once "afraid" to approach him while he was wheelchair-bound.
“[Maven] was a baby when I first came home from the hospital, so she was scared of the wheelchair. She wouldn’t come over to me… I took that personally," Tracy said.

Nearly one year ago, Tracy suffered a broken leg, nose and ribs in addition to a traumatic brain injury when a Walmart truck slammed into a limo van carrying the star and his friends — one of which, James McNair, was killed during the crash — on the New Jersey Turnpike in June 2014.

Thankfully, the 30 Rock star's fiancée, Megan Wollover, 28, and his sons, Gitrid, 22, Malcolm, 26, and Tracy Jr., 27 — from his previous marriage to Sabina Morgan — were on hand to help him recover from the accident.

“[They] guided me and said, ‘No, she’s a baby and she’ll come around.' She was young. I was in a wheelchair every day. [But] my fiancée and my son, they wouldn’t let me just lie down.”
Now, Maven — whose first word was "Dada!" — couldn't be more affectionate toward her famous father, Tracy added.
“I would ask her, ‘Do you know I’m your dad?’ She knows that now and that’s what’s important to me. It’s Dada. She loves her daddy and she knows who her daddy is," Tracy told People.
